Alpha oxidation of dietary phytanic acid takes place in which of the following cell structures?
Correct Answer: Peroxisomes
Description: Alpha-oxidation takes place in peroxisomes to break down dietary phytanic acid, which cannot undergo beta-oxidation due to its b-methyl branch, into pristanic acid, which can. Alpha oxidation (a-oxidation) is a process by which ceain fatty acids are broken down by removal of a single carbon from the carboxyl end.
